Double layer (plasma physics)A double layer is a structure in a plasma consisting of two parallel layers of opposite electrical charge. The sheets of charge, which are not necessarily planar, produce localised excursions of electric potential, resulting in a relatively strong electric field between the layers and weaker but more extensive compensating fields outside, which restore the global potential. Ions and electrons within the double layer are accelerated, decelerated, or deflected by the electric field, depending on their direction of motion.
Observatoire solaire et héliosphériqueL’Observatoire solaire et héliosphérique, en anglais Solar and Heliospheric Observatory, en abrégé SoHO, est un observatoire solaire spatial placé en orbite autour du Soleil. Son objectif principal est l'étude de la structure interne du Soleil, des processus produisant le vent solaire et de la couronne solaire. SoHO est sélectionné en 1984 dans le cadre du programme scientifique de l'Agence spatiale européenne.
Rayon δA delta ray is a secondary electron with enough energy to escape a significant distance away from the primary radiation beam and produce further ionization, and is sometimes used to describe any recoil particle caused by secondary ionization. The term was coined by J. J. Thomson. A delta ray is characterized by very fast electrons produced in quantity by alpha particles or other fast energetic charged particles knocking orbiting electrons out of atoms.
